Automated Cyborg Cockroach Manufacturing unit May Churn Out a Bug a Minute for Search and Rescue


Envisioning armies of electronically controllable bugs might be nightmare gas for most individuals. However scientists suppose they may assist rescue employees scour difficult and unsafe terrain. An automatic cyborg cockroach manufacturing unit might assist convey the concept to life.

The merger of dwelling creatures with machines is a staple of science fiction, but it surely’s additionally a critical line of analysis for lecturers. A number of teams have implanted electronics into moths, beetles, and cockroaches that enable easy management of the bugs.

Nevertheless, constructing these cyborgs is hard because it takes appreciable dexterity and persistence to surgically implant electrodes of their delicate our bodies. Which means that creating sufficient for many sensible purposes is just too time-consuming.

To beat this impediment, researchers at Nanyang Technological College in Singapore have automated the method, utilizing a robotic arm with pc imaginative and prescient to put in electrodes and tiny backpacks stuffed with electronics on Madagascar hissing cockroaches. The strategy cuts the time required to connect the tools from roughly half an hour to simply over a minute.

“Sooner or later, factories for insect-computer hybrid robotic[s] could possibly be constructed to fulfill the wants for quick preparation and utility of the hybrid robots,” the researchers write in a non-peer-reviewed paper on arXiv.

“Completely different sensors could possibly be added to the backpack to develop purposes on the inspection and search missions based mostly on the necessities.”

Cyborg bugs could possibly be a promising various to standard robots due to their small dimension, skill to function for hours on little meals, and their adaptability to new environments. In addition to serving to with search and rescue operations, the researchers counsel that swarms of those robotic bugs could possibly be used to examine factories.

The researchers had already proven that indicators from electrodes implanted into cockroach abdomens could possibly be used to regulate the course of journey and get them to decelerate and even cease. However putting in these electrodes and a small backpack with management electronics required painstaking work from a skilled researcher.

That form of strategy makes it troublesome to scale as much as the lots of and even hundreds of bugs required for virtually helpful swarms. So, the group developed an automatic system that would set up the electronics on a cockroach with minimal human involvement.

First, the researchers anesthetized the cockroaches by exposing them to carbon dioxide for 10 minutes. They then positioned the bugs on a platform the place a pair of rods powered by a motor pressed down on two segments of their laborious exoskeletons to reveal a smooth membrane simply behind the pinnacle.

A pc imaginative and prescient system then recognized the place to implant the electrodes and used this data to information a robotic arm carrying the digital backpack. Electrodes in place, the arm pressed the backpack down till its mounting mechanism hooked into one other part of the insect’s physique. The arm then launched the backpack, and the rods retracted to free the cyborg bug.

The complete meeting course of takes simply 68 seconds, and the ensuing cockroaches are simply as controllable as ones made manually, the researchers discovered. A four-bug group was in a position to cowl 80 % of a 20-square-foot outside take a look at atmosphere crammed with obstacles in about 10 minutes.

Fabian Steinbeck at Bielefeld College in Germany advised New Scientist that utilizing these cyborg bugs for search and rescue could be tough as they presently should be managed remotely. Getting sign in collapsed buildings and related difficult terrain could be troublesome, and we don’t but have the know-how to get them to navigate autonomously.

Fast enhancements in each AI and communication applied sciences might quickly change that although. So, it will not be too far-fetched to think about swarms of robotic bugs coming to your rescue within the close to future.
